It's a new month, which means a new set of Xbox free Games with Gold games. Xbox Live Gold subscribers are usually treated to four free games every month, with two of those titles for Xbox One and two for Xbox 360. Unlike the free PS Plus games, the Xbox free Games with Gold games are staggered throughout the month, so subscribers don't get access to them all at once. So while not all of the Xbox free Games with Gold for November 2021 are available to Xbox Live Gold subscribers, the first two have been added.

Xbox Live Gold subscribers can now claim two of the Xbox free Games with Gold for November 2021. From November 1 to November 30, Gold subscribers can claim the co-op game Moving Out, which is all about working for a moving company. Moving Out has a quirky sense of humor and style that has earned it comparisons to the Overcooked series, so co-op minded gamers should definitely claim it while it's up for grabs.

And from November 1 to November 15, Xbox Live Gold subscribers can claim Rocket Knight for their collection. Rocket Knight is a modern take on the classic Sega character Sparkster, for the uninitiated.

Xbox Free Games with Gold for November 2021

  • Moving Out (November 1 - November 30)
  • Kingdom Two Crowns (November 16 - December 15)
  • Rocket Knight (November 1 - November 15)
  • LEGO Batman 2: DC Super Heroes (November 16 - November 30)

Later in November, Xbox Live Gold subscribers will have some other games to claim. From November 16 to December 15, Xbox Live Gold subscribers can claim the strategy game Kingdom Two Crowns, while November 16 to November 30 will see the addition of LEGO Batman 2: DC Super Heroes. Meanwhile, Xbox Live Gold subscribers can also claim one of the free Games with Gold games for October 2021 that's leftover for November, as Hover will be free until November 15.
